Srebrna Góra Fortress is a vast Prussian mountain stronghold built in the second half of the 18th century, guarding a mountain pass above the Kłodzko Valley. It ranks among the largest and best-preserved mountain fortresses in Europe and, despite a Napoleonic siege, was never captured. Tours of the massive bastioned keep, exhibitions and historical re-enactments make it a popular destination for families and history lovers alike. The picturesque village of Srebrna Góra is a pleasant starting point for trips around the region's northern gateway.
